Webflocculation, in physical chemistry, separation of solid particles from a liquid to form loose aggregations or soft flakes. These flocculates are easily disrupted, being held together … WebFlocculation is a two-step particle aggregation process in which a large number of small particles form a small number large flocs. Particles finer than 0.1 µm (10 m) in water remain continuously in motion due to electrostatic charge (often negative) which causes them to repel each other. Once their electrostatic charge is neutralized by the use of a coagulant chemical, the finer particles start to collide and agglomerate (collect together) under the influence of Van der Waals forces.
